Deep Learning Specialization on Coursera

课程主页: https://www.udemy.com/course/supercharged-web-scraping-with-asyncio-and-python/

在如今的数据驱动时代,网络爬虫(Web Scraping)变得愈发重要。无论是用于数据科学、自动化还是机器学习,网络爬虫都是获取和解析互联网数据的基础。今天,我想和大家分享一门非常实用的课程:Udemy上的《Supercharged Web Scraping with Asyncio and Python》。

### 课程概述
这门课程的核心是教你如何使用Python进行网络爬虫,尤其是如何利用Asyncio实现异步爬虫。课程内容涵盖了基础的网络爬虫技术,例如使用Selenium进行爬虫,以及同步与异步的区别。最让我感兴趣的是异步编程,它允许我们几乎同时执行多个函数,这在处理大量网页时可以节省显著的时间。

### 为什么选择异步编程?
异步编程的优势在于它支持并发执行,这意味着我们可以在更短的时间内完成更多的任务。在网络爬虫的场景中,比如如果你想要爬取成千上万的网页,使用同步方法会显得非常低效。而异步编程可以让你在等待响应的同时,继续进行其他请求,从而大幅提高爬虫的效率。

### 适合人群
这门课程特别适合那些已经有一定网络爬虫基础的开发者,尤其是那些希望将自己的爬虫技术提升到新高度的学习者。如果你之前使用过Python的requests库或Selenium,但对异步编程还不太了解,那么这门课程将是你的不二之选。

### 总结
总的来说,《Supercharged Web Scraping with Asyncio and Python》是一门内容丰富且实用性强的课程。通过这门课程,你不仅能够掌握基本的网络爬虫技巧,还能深入理解并应用异步编程,从而提升你的数据抓取能力。无论你是想为自己的项目获取数据,还是希望在数据科学领域发展,这门课程都能为你提供极大的帮助。强烈推荐给大家!

快来加入这门课程,提升你的网络爬虫技能吧!

课程主页: https://www.udemy.com/course/supercharged-web-scraping-with-asyncio-and-python/

作者 CourseEye